Storing nuts properly is essential to maintain their freshness, flavor, and nutritional value, as they are prone to spoilage due to their high oil content. While nuts can be stored at room temperature in a cool, dry place, refrigeration is often recommended to extend their shelf life, especially for larger quantities or in warmer climates. Refrigerating nuts helps slow down the oxidation process, which can cause them to become rancid, and also prevents the growth of mold or pests. However, it’s important to store them in airtight containers to protect them from moisture and odors in the fridge. For even longer preservation, nuts can be frozen, though refrigeration is a practical and effective option for most households.

Optimal Storage Conditions: Best practices for refrigerating nuts to maintain freshness and extend shelf life

Storing nuts in the refrigerator is an excellent way to maintain their freshness and extend their shelf life, especially for those with high oil content like walnuts, pecans, and almonds. Nuts are prone to becoming rancid due to their natural oils, which can oxidize when exposed to air, light, and heat. Refrigeration slows down this process by keeping the temperature consistently cool, typically between 35°F and 40°F (2°C and 4°C). This optimal temperature range significantly reduces the activity of enzymes and microorganisms that contribute to spoilage. For best results, ensure your refrigerator maintains this temperature range and avoid placing nuts in the door, where temperature fluctuations are more common.

To maximize freshness, proper packaging is crucial when refrigerating nuts. Airtight containers are highly recommended to prevent moisture absorption and exposure to odors from other foods. Glass jars or BPA-free plastic containers with tight-fitting lids work well. Alternatively, vacuum-sealed bags can be used to remove excess air, further protecting the nuts from oxidation. If using original packaging, transfer the nuts to an airtight container after opening, as most store-bought packaging is not designed for long-term storage. Labeling containers with the storage date can also help you keep track of freshness.

While refrigeration is beneficial, freezing is an even better option for long-term storage, especially if you plan to keep nuts for more than a few months. Freezing temperatures, around 0°F (-18°C), virtually halt the oxidation process and preserve nut quality for up to a year. To freeze nuts, follow the same packaging guidelines as for refrigeration, ensuring they are in airtight, moisture-proof containers or bags. Allow frozen nuts to come to room temperature before opening the packaging to avoid condensation, which can lead to mold or texture changes.

Regardless of whether you refrigerate or freeze nuts, proper handling is essential to maintain their quality. Always use clean utensils when scooping nuts to avoid introducing contaminants. Additionally, avoid frequent temperature changes by minimizing the time nuts spend at room temperature. If you need to use a portion of refrigerated or frozen nuts, measure out what you need and return the rest to cold storage promptly. This practice helps maintain a consistent environment and prevents the nuts from warming up, which can accelerate spoilage.

Lastly, consider the type of nuts and their intended use when deciding on storage methods. Raw nuts benefit the most from refrigeration or freezing, while roasted or flavored nuts may have a shorter shelf life due to added ingredients. If you plan to use nuts for baking or snacking within a few weeks, refrigeration is sufficient. However, for bulk purchases or nuts intended for long-term storage, freezing is the superior choice. By following these best practices, you can ensure that your nuts remain fresh, flavorful, and safe to consume for an extended period.

Shelf Life Impact: How refrigeration affects the longevity of different types of nuts

Refrigerating nuts can significantly impact their shelf life, but the effects vary depending on the type of nut and its specific characteristics. Nuts are generally high in healthy fats, which are prone to oxidation when exposed to air, light, and heat. This oxidation process leads to rancidity, causing nuts to develop an off flavor and aroma. Refrigeration slows down this process by reducing the temperature, which in turn decreases the rate of chemical reactions. For example, almonds, walnuts, and pecans, which are rich in polyunsaturated fats, benefit greatly from refrigeration. At room temperature, these nuts can become rancid within a few months, but when stored in the refrigerator, their shelf life can extend to up to a year or more.

However, not all nuts require refrigeration to maintain their freshness. Nuts with higher monounsaturated fat content, such as macadamia nuts and hazelnuts, are more stable at room temperature and can last several months without refrigeration. Additionally, nuts that have been roasted or salted often have a longer shelf life due to the added processing steps, which can reduce moisture content and inhibit microbial growth. For these types of nuts, refrigeration is optional but can still provide a slight extension in shelf life, especially in humid environments where moisture absorption is a concern.

The impact of refrigeration on shelled versus unshelled nuts is another important consideration. Unshelled nuts, such as those still in their natural protective shell, have a longer shelf life overall because the shell acts as a barrier against air and moisture. Refrigeration can further extend the life of unshelled nuts by keeping them in a cool, stable environment. Shelled nuts, on the other hand, are more susceptible to spoilage because they lack this natural protection. For shelled nuts, refrigeration is highly recommended to preserve their freshness and prevent rancidity. Storing them in airtight containers within the refrigerator minimizes exposure to air and moisture, ensuring they remain edible for a longer period.

Humidity and temperature fluctuations can also affect the shelf life of nuts, making refrigeration a practical solution in certain climates. In hot and humid environments, nuts stored at room temperature are more likely to absorb moisture, leading to mold growth or spoilage. Refrigeration provides a consistent, cool environment that mitigates these risks. For those living in such climates, refrigerating all types of nuts, regardless of their fat composition, is advisable to maintain optimal quality. Conversely, in cooler, drier climates, some nuts may fare well in a pantry, though refrigeration remains beneficial for long-term storage.

Lastly, it’s essential to consider the storage method when refrigerating nuts to maximize their shelf life. Nuts should be stored in airtight containers or vacuum-sealed bags to prevent them from absorbing odors from other foods in the refrigerator and to minimize exposure to air. Labeling containers with the storage date can also help track freshness. For those who prefer not to refrigerate, storing nuts in a cool, dark pantry in airtight containers is a viable alternative, though the shelf life will be shorter compared to refrigerated storage. Understanding these nuances ensures that nuts remain fresh and flavorful for as long as possible, whether refrigerated or stored at room temperature.

Moisture Concerns: Risks of moisture absorption and proper packaging for refrigerated nuts

Storing nuts in the refrigerator can be an effective way to extend their shelf life, especially for those with high oil content like walnuts, pecans, and almonds. However, moisture absorption is a significant concern when refrigerating nuts. Nuts are naturally hygroscopic, meaning they readily absorb moisture from their surroundings. When exposed to the humid environment of a refrigerator, particularly if not properly packaged, nuts can become damp. This moisture absorption can lead to several issues, including mold growth, rancidity, and a loss of crunchiness. Mold growth is particularly problematic as it can render the nuts unsafe to eat, while rancidity affects their flavor and nutritional value. Therefore, understanding the risks and implementing proper packaging techniques is crucial for anyone considering refrigerating nuts.

One of the primary risks of moisture absorption is the degradation of the nuts' texture and taste. Moisture can cause nuts to become soft and chewy, losing their desirable crispness. Additionally, moisture accelerates the oxidation of the oils in nuts, leading to rancidity. This process not only ruins the flavor but also diminishes the health benefits associated with the nuts' healthy fats. To mitigate these risks, it is essential to minimize the nuts' exposure to moisture. This begins with choosing the right packaging materials. Airtight containers are a must, as they create a barrier between the nuts and the humid refrigerator air. Glass jars or plastic containers with secure lids work well, but for added protection, consider using vacuum-sealed bags or Mylar bags designed for food storage.

Proper packaging also involves the use of moisture-absorbing agents. Including a silica gel packet in the container can help absorb any excess moisture that might seep in. Silica gel is a desiccant that effectively keeps the environment dry, safeguarding the nuts from humidity. Another option is to use oxygen absorbers, which not only reduce moisture but also prevent oxidation, further extending the nuts' freshness. These packets are small, inexpensive, and readily available online or in stores specializing in food storage supplies. By incorporating these moisture-control measures, you can significantly reduce the risks associated with refrigerating nuts.

When preparing nuts for refrigeration, it’s important to ensure they are completely dry before storing. Even a small amount of residual moisture from washing or handling can accelerate spoilage. If you’ve roasted or seasoned the nuts, allow them to cool to room temperature before packaging. Warm nuts can create condensation inside the container, increasing the risk of moisture absorption. Additionally, label the containers with the storage date to keep track of how long the nuts have been refrigerated. Most nuts can last up to a year in the refrigerator when stored properly, but it’s best to consume them within six months for optimal quality.

Finally, consider portioning the nuts into smaller quantities before refrigerating. This minimizes the number of times the main container is opened, reducing the exposure to moisture and air each time. For example, store nuts in individual servings or weekly portions in smaller airtight containers or bags. This practice not only preserves freshness but also makes it convenient to grab a portion without compromising the rest. By addressing moisture concerns through proper packaging and storage techniques, you can safely refrigerate nuts and enjoy their freshness and flavor for an extended period.

Flavor Preservation: Does refrigeration alter the taste or texture of nuts over time?

Refrigerating nuts is a common practice to extend their shelf life, but it’s essential to understand how this storage method impacts their flavor and texture over time. Nuts contain natural oils that contribute to their rich taste and crunchy texture. When stored at room temperature, these oils can oxidize more quickly, leading to rancidity and a decline in flavor. Refrigeration slows this oxidation process by maintaining a cooler environment, which helps preserve the freshness of the nuts. However, the question remains: does refrigeration itself alter the taste or texture of nuts? The answer lies in how the nuts interact with their storage conditions.

One concern with refrigerating nuts is the potential for moisture absorption, which can affect both flavor and texture. Refrigerators are inherently humid environments, and if nuts are not stored in airtight containers, they can absorb moisture from the air. This moisture can make nuts soggy, compromising their crunchiness and altering their texture. Additionally, moisture can accelerate the breakdown of the nuts' oils, leading to off-flavors or a stale taste. To mitigate this, it’s crucial to store nuts in airtight containers or vacuum-sealed bags when refrigerating them. This simple step can significantly reduce the risk of moisture-related flavor and texture changes.

Another factor to consider is temperature fluctuations within the refrigerator. Frequent opening and closing of the refrigerator door can cause temperature shifts, which may impact the nuts' quality. Consistent cold temperatures are ideal for preserving nuts, but rapid changes can cause condensation to form on the nuts, especially when they are taken out and exposed to room temperature. This condensation can lead to mold growth or texture degradation. To avoid this, allow refrigerated nuts to come to room temperature gradually before opening their container. This practice helps maintain their intended flavor and texture.

Despite these considerations, refrigeration generally has a minimal direct impact on the inherent taste of nuts if done correctly. The primary benefit of refrigeration is its ability to slow the degradation of the nuts' oils, which are responsible for their flavor. When stored properly, refrigerated nuts can retain their freshness and taste for up to six months, compared to just a few weeks at room temperature. However, it’s worth noting that some nuts, like walnuts and pecans, are more prone to oil rancidity and may benefit more from refrigeration than others.

In conclusion, refrigeration is an effective method for preserving the flavor and texture of nuts over time, but it requires careful attention to storage conditions. Using airtight containers, minimizing exposure to moisture, and maintaining consistent temperatures are key to ensuring that refrigerated nuts remain fresh and flavorful. While refrigeration does not inherently alter the taste or texture of nuts, improper storage practices can lead to undesirable changes. For those looking to maximize the shelf life of nuts without compromising their quality, refrigeration is a recommended strategy when paired with the right techniques.

Freezing vs. Refrigeration: Comparing the benefits and drawbacks of freezing versus refrigerating nuts

When considering the storage of nuts, both freezing and refrigeration are viable options to extend their shelf life, but each method comes with its own set of benefits and drawbacks. Nuts are rich in healthy fats, which makes them susceptible to rancidity when exposed to heat, light, and air. Proper storage is essential to maintain their freshness, flavor, and nutritional value. Refrigeration and freezing are both effective methods, but the choice between the two depends on how long you plan to store the nuts and the convenience you require.

Refrigeration of Nuts:

Refrigerating nuts is a practical option for short to medium-term storage, typically up to 6 months. The cool temperature of a refrigerator (around 40°F or 4°C) slows down the oxidation process, which is the primary cause of rancidity in nuts. Refrigeration is particularly useful for nuts stored in their shells, as the shell provides an additional barrier against moisture and air. However, shelled nuts should be stored in airtight containers to prevent them from absorbing odors from other foods in the fridge. One drawback of refrigeration is that it is less effective for long-term storage, as nuts can still gradually lose their freshness over time. Additionally, frequent opening of the refrigerator can expose nuts to temperature fluctuations, which may accelerate spoilage.

Freezing of Nuts:

Freezing nuts is the best method for long-term storage, as it can extend their shelf life up to 2 years. The extremely low temperature of a freezer (0°F or -18°C) virtually halts the oxidation process, preserving the nuts' flavor, texture, and nutritional value. Freezing is ideal for both shelled and unshelled nuts, but proper packaging is crucial. Nuts should be stored in airtight, moisture-proof containers or vacuum-sealed bags to prevent freezer burn, which occurs when nuts are exposed to air and moisture. One drawback of freezing is the inconvenience of thawing nuts before use, as using them directly from the freezer can affect their texture. Additionally, freezing requires more storage space compared to refrigeration, which may be a limitation for some households.

Comparing Convenience and Practicality:

Refrigeration is more convenient for everyday use, as nuts can be easily accessed and used without the need for thawing. It is a suitable option for those who consume nuts regularly and in smaller quantities. On the other hand, freezing is more practical for bulk storage or for those who purchase nuts in large quantities and want to preserve them for an extended period. However, the need to plan ahead for thawing can be a minor inconvenience. Both methods require proper packaging to maximize their effectiveness, but freezing demands more attention to detail to avoid freezer burn.

In conclusion, both freezing and refrigeration are effective methods for storing nuts, but the choice depends on your specific needs. Refrigeration is ideal for short to medium-term storage and everyday convenience, while freezing is the best option for long-term preservation. Proper packaging is essential for both methods to ensure maximum freshness and prevent spoilage. By understanding the benefits and drawbacks of each, you can make an informed decision to keep your nuts in optimal condition.
